Ticket #4412 — Report exports drifting again

Hey on-call — the nightly report exports from Quillbox are stamping timestamps in UTC for some tenants and local time for others. Looks like the prod config for the export worker drifted from what's in the repo; someone hot-patched the timezone default last sprint and it never got committed. Before you fix anything, compare against the live values below.

deployment values, hahaf-fahop:
zorwyn:
  log_level: debug
  metrics_host: metrics.zorwyn.tolvaqlabs.internal
  pool_size: 8

Runbook: StockTally reconciliation job. Runs nightly against the Verdane warehouse snapshot. If counts diverge by more than 2%, the job halts and pages on-call. Plugin authors: hooks fire after the diff phase, before write-back. Do not mutate the snapshot. Restart only via the scheduler, never manually. Connect using the configuration below.

service settings:
PRAIX_LOG_LEVEL=error
PRAIX_METRICS_HOST=metrics.praix.qorvelcorp.corp
PRAIX_POOL_SIZE=16

TICKET: metrics-sidecar leaks tenant labels. The Fernwick aggregation sidecar (project Quillhawk) forwards raw pod annotations to the shared metrics bus without the scrub filter enabled. Security impact: cross-tenant label disclosure in dashboards. Repro: deploy two tenants, query the bus, observe both label sets. Fix lands in the next sidecar build; scrub filter becomes default-on. The affected artifact is tagged with the following token.

build token for kagaf-hahof: htk14_9d3d4d26d7d8de